Rudy (Rudolph) Carl Schreider, Jr. passed on September 2 at 6 AM. Rudy was born at home in the Heights of Houston, TX on October 5, 1942 to Francis and Rudolph Schreider. He attended Reagan H.S. and Rice University on football scholarship where he graduated in 1965 with a Master's Degree in accounting. He and his family moved to Denver, Colorado in 1976. He worked for Touche Ross as a CPA from 1966-1980, and was self-employed at Quantum Resources until 1984 and American Atlas Resource Corporation until 2017. He was an avid fisherman and hunter, as well as an accomplished carpenter and user of tools. He delighted in the company of his family and friends. He was a patient and inexhaustible teacher and a source of inspiration to everyone he touched. Rudy is survived by his devoted wife Gretchen Ragland, siblings Carolyn Anthrop (Don Sr.), Richard Schreider (Amy) and Robert Schreider (Doris), first wife Carol Schreider, children Laura Suzanne Schreider and Rudy (Rudolph) Carl Schreider III and grandchildren Raymond, Nicholas, Joseph and Owen. Preceded in death by parents and brother Raymond Schreider. In lieu of flowers, please send donations to Parkinson's Foundation at Parkinson.org. Memorial service announcement will be forthcoming.
